The Open Source Observatory (OSO) is dedicated to Free/Libre/Open Source Software and is intended to encourage the spread and use of best practices in Europe's public sector.

This section of the IDABC website provides news about the latest FLOSS-related developments and events in the public sector. Monthly case studies examine in-depth how administrations use FLOSS to their advantage. This site is also the home of the European Union Public License, offering documentation and answering frequent questions. Expert studies on various aspects of FLOSS are offered for download.
